Summary

Senate Resolution No. 346 serves as a memorial to Carmen M. Garcia, honoring her contributions and the respect she garnered throughout her life. The resolution reflects the sentiments of the Texas Senate as they recognize her legacy and express condolences to her family and community. Carmen M. Garcia, who passed away at the age of 88, was celebrated for her lifelong commitment to service and the values she instilled in her family and loved ones. Her professional career spanned 35 years, culminating in her position as a senior social worker for the Texas Department of Human Resources.
